Picks of the Week: Work that wowed us

Every Friday, Campaign India picks its favourites from the work published on the website

Picks of the Week: Work that wowed us

Campaign India's editorial team has picked their favourite campaigns from those published on the website during the week.

 

This week, the team found two pieces of work that stood out. 

 

As always, we're going alphabetically:

 

Cult.fit (conceptualised by Bare Bones Collective)

A resolution to work out this year without spelling it out! Nothing preachy about it!

 

The films, through relatable binge-worthy content gives its consumers a reality check and encourges them to kickstart their fitness journey.

 

Lenskart (conceptualised by Tanmay Bhat, Puneet Chadha, Devaiah Bopanna, Deep Joshi and Vishal Dayama)

The brand film uses reverse psychology to showcase how the protagonist is looking for a more expensive price tag to maintain status-quo for an affordable product which he’s smitten by. The dialogue between Karan Johar and the brand’s founder makes it look even more authentic.
